Adjustable storage system for clothing
09532672 · 2017-01-03 ·

A system for storing unfolded garments, such as shirts and sweaters, on multiple shelves. The shelves may be curved from side to side and raised in the middle. The shelves may be placed at intermittent variable points along a vertical support member which attaches to a wall or to a base. The multiple shelves attach to brackets which extend from the vertical support member at vertically spaced points along the length of the vertical support member. The system permits the shelves to slide out from the vertical support member for convenient access.

Stackable space saving system and method of use
12564281 · 2026-03-03 ·

The present invention provides a plurality of stackable, space saving system of bowls which may form a three-or four-tiered tower of bowls that are stably locked upright in place using a twist and lock mechanism located on each of the bowls. The bowls are stackable due to having sdifferent-sized, molded, elongated elliptical members that telescopically fit one into the other so that the tower is collapsible into a compact, space-saving configuration. In addition, each of the plurality of bowls may be used singly with an accompanying airtight lid.
